Transaction 62a44dce1bec67d6cf1e6a85be9f340d5b6164efc67cff6c8ba91e7d0dbd43e5
1 Input
1 Output
-
62a44dce1bec67d6cf1e6a85be9f340d5b6164efc67cff6c8ba91e7d0dbd43e5:0
- value
- 2128539
- script pubkey
- OP_0 OP_PUSHBYTES_20 cfd3d4535cd55278ebc4408e2fa914683988cb45
- address
- bc1qelfag56u64f8367ygz8zl2g5dquc3j695h9tvw